Lando Norris, Max Verstappen and Lewis Hamilton sure make for a tantalising top three on the grid for the 2024 Singapore Grand Prix – but will it be that trio who make it onto Sunday evening’s podium?
Norris has looked in the groove at the Marina Bay Street Circuit since his very first flying lap of Free Practice 1, but is yet to lead a Lap 1 after qualifying on pole position.

Title rival Max Verstappen starts alongside, the Dutch driver on the front row here for the first time since 2018 – while four-time Singapore victor Hamilton is next up, lining up alongside team mate George Russell, who infamously crashed out of last year’s race on the final lap.
